Regarding the aircond compressor, yes, my sedan Accord Euro does the same from new. You can even feel the compressor vibration through the steering wheel when at full stop idle.
My motor doesn't have a tick, but it is loud, louder than the K24 in the CRV. I think it's the camshaft assembly + chain that is loud. The CRV's K24 also has a cam chain, so I'm not sure why the Accord's is louder.
